Microsoft Sentinel centralizes telemetry and provides a scalable SIEM foundation. But visibility alone does not guarantee high-fidelity detection.
Many SOC teams still rely on static rules, threshold-based logic, and manually tuned detection content that can be difficult to build, validate, and maintain scale. Sentinel’s 50 NRT rule limit can also constrain real-time detection strategies, forcing teams to choose which detections run near real time and which are delayed, deprioritized, or never built.
At the same time, sophisticated attacks rarely stay inside one control plane. Insider threats, identity misuse, ransomware, cloud compromise, and advanced persistent threat activity often unfold across users, entities, endpoints, cloud platforms, SaaS applications, and third-party environments.
To detect these threats earlier, security teams need behavioral context, entity profiling, anomaly detection, threat intelligence, and cross-environment correlation.

Microsoft Sentinel continues to serve as the primary data lake, investigation console, and response workflow for alerts and telemetry across identity, cloud, SaaS, endpoint, and enterprise environments.
Securonix analyzes telemetry already collected by Sentinel using behavioral analytics, anomaly detection, entity profiling, threat intelligence enrichment, advanced correlation, and risk scoring.
Securonix adds unlimited real-time detections beyond Sentinel’s 50 NRT rule limit and applies more than 2,400 continuously maintained Threat Labs–backed detections, reducing the need for customers to build and maintain detection content themselves.
Risk-scored detections, enriched alerts, behavioral anomalies, and prioritized incidents are sent back into Sentinel so analysts can investigate and respond in their existing workflows.
